Cleaning Up is a South Korean television series starring Yum Jung-ah, Jeon So-min, and Kim Jae-Hwa that is based on the 2019 British series of the same name. It first aired on JTBC on June 4, 2022, and is broadcast every Saturday and Sunday at 22:30. (KST) on JTBC.
It tells the story of three cleaners at a financial firm, who resort to insider trading to feed their families and realise their goals after unintentionally overhearing financial information.

Cleaning Up Kdrama Plot Synopsis
Cleaning Up is the story of three women, Eo Yong-Mi (Yum Jung-Ah), An In-Kyung (Jeon So-Min), and Maeng Soo-Ja (Kim Jae-Hwa) who work in a brokerage firm.
Eo Yong-Mi is a single mother who tries to support her two daughters. In-Kyung fantasises about purchasing a food truck and opening a mobile cafe. Maeng Soo-Ja appears to be a gregarious individual, yet she only interacts with others when she needs them. At their workplace, these three cleaning ladies happen to overhear insider information. They use insider trading information to invest their money in a stock.
